As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Abbs Valley-Boissevain Elementary School in the United States is $39.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$80,661. Salaries at Abbs Valley-Boissevain Elementary School typically range from $34 to $44 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company. Abbs Valley-Boissevain Elementary School’s salaries are influenced by a wide range of factors including job role, department, years of experience, and location.
DISCLAIMER: The salary range presented here is an estimation that has been derived from our proprietary algorithm. It should be noted that this range does not originate from the company's factual payroll records or survey data.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Charleston?

Understanding the cost of living near Charleston is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Abbs Valley-Boissevain Elementary School.
Charleston's Cost of Living Index is approximately 78.5 (21.5% less expensive than US average; 10.3% less than WV average). State capital, very affordable housing. KRT b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Abbs Valley-Boissevain Elementary School,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$700 - $1,050+ A significant portion of Abbs Valley-Boissevain Elementary School sal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$230 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$40 (KRT mon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$360 - $530 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$300 - $580+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$350 - $650+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$1,920 - $3,040+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
